Four Seasons Resort Oahu at Ko Olina is a polished beach resort on Oahu's west coast, set beside the protected Ko Olina lagoons rather than the busier hotel blocks of Waikiki. That location defines the stay. Guests come here for calmer water, open sunset views, resort space, and an easier pace, while still staying on Oahu with access to Honolulu, Pearl Harbor, the North Shore, and island drives. The resort works best for travelers who want Hawaii with structure. The lagoons are easier for swimming than many open-ocean beaches, which makes the setting attractive for families, couples, and multigenerational trips. It also suits guests who want Four Seasons service, strong restaurants, pools, spa time, and golf nearby without needing to plan every hour outside the resort. This is not the right hotel for guests who want to step into Waikiki nightlife each evening. It is better for travelers who prefer a true resort rhythm.
